Forçar wget proxy para proxy não ambiente

3

Existe uma maneira de forçar o wget a usar um proxy de squid específico ao fazer conexões? Eu normalmente uso um proxy do squid, mas eu preciso desse pedido específico para passar por um diferente. Eu não tenho que usar wget ; Eu só preciso de uma maneira de testar as regras de bloqueio do squid, solicitando várias páginas através dele. Esse proxy não é meu proxy normal na rede e, portanto, não posso confiar em wget usando a variável de ambiente.

Além disso, isso é parte de um script, então qualquer coisa que evite editar wget config files seria melhor. Pode curl fazer isso? Atualmente estou usando o código de saída de wget para determinar se a conexão foi feita.

    
por Sirex 17.08.2010 / 15:19

1 resposta

5

Você pode definir a variável de ambiente http_proxy apenas para uma chamada específica de wget:

http_proxy=http://specific-squid-proxy-host:3129/ wget http://server/page
    
por 17.08.2010 / 16:03